1. An apparatus for receiving and dispensing hot or cold liquids, comprising:

  • a thermally insulating container having a top, the top of said insulating container having an opening provided therein and a lid mountable on the top to close the opening, said insulating container having an inner space;

    a gas-tight inner container positioned in the insulating container, said inner container being made of a flexible material that is collapsible into a flat state and which, in an empty and vacuous state, is introducible into the insulating container and which can be filled while being located in the insulating container, said inner container filling up substantially the entire inner space of the insulating container when the inner container is filled with liquid, said inner container including a connecting piece;

    an air pipe for venting the inner space of the insulating container, said air pipe extending from the inner space of the insulating container through the lid and opening to outside the apparatus;

    a flexible tube connected to the connecting piece of the inner container, said flexible tube extending through a channel formed in a side wall of the said insulating container and opening to outside the apparatus;

    a valve coupling operatively associated with said flexible tube, said valve coupling including automatic closing means for automatically closing access to and from the inner container through the tube, said tube being connectable to filler means for filling the inner container with liquid, said automatic closing means being openable to allow liquid to flow into the inner container when the filler means is connected to the tube and being automatically closed to prevent liquid from being dispensed from the inner container when the filler means is disconnected from the tube, said tube also being connectable to a tap for dispensing liquid from the inner container, said automatic closing means being openable to allow liquid to flow from the inner container when the tap is connected to the tube and being automatically closed to prevent liquid from being dispensed from the inner container when the tap is disconnected from the tube.
